Transaction 640a058d19a46fca88d28c1806f43c5989e363459a55f00f04be92fb301e38ec

1 Input
2 Outputs
  • 640a058d19a46fca88d28c1806f43c5989e363459a55f00f04be92fb301e38ec:0
  • value  7038270
    address  12f5vFX295VCuj4rkMoH76a9JUPAMx3iBB
  • 640a058d19a46fca88d28c1806f43c5989e363459a55f00f04be92fb301e38ec:1
  • value  324135453
    address  15WjknQ6Ag8LfSyYovYr5wufdv3qG2eifK